/*
* SBus front-end for the GEM network driver
*/

#include <sys/cdefs.h>
__K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: if_gem_sbus.c,v 1.14 2022/09/25 18:03:04 thorpej Exp $");

#include <sys/param.h>
#include <sys/systm.h>
#include <sys/syslog.h>
#include <sys/device.h>
#include <sys/socket.h>

#include <net/if.h>
#include <net/if_dl.h>
#include <net/if_ether.h>
#include <net/if_media.h>

#include <dev/mii/mii.h>
#include <dev/mii/miivar.h>

#include <sys/bus.h>
#include <sys/intr.h>
#include <machine/autoconf.h>

#include <dev/sbus/sbusvar.h>

#include <dev/ic/gemreg.h>
#include <dev/ic/gemvar.h>

struct gem_sbus_softc {
       struct  gem_softc       gsc_gem;        /* GEM device */
       void                    *gsc_ih;
       bus_space_handle_t      gsc_sbus_regs_h;
};

int     gemmatch_sbus(device_t, cfdata_t, void *);
void    gemattach_sbus(device_t, device_t, void *);

CFATTACH_DECL3_NEW(gem_sbus, sizeof(struct gem_sbus_softc),
   gemmatch_sbus, gemattach_sbus, NULL, NULL, NULL, NULL, 0);

int
gemmatch_sbus(device_t parent, cfdata_t cf, void *aux)
{
       struct sbus_attach_args *sa = aux;

       return (strcmp("network", sa->sa_name) == 0);
}

void
gemattach_sbus(device_t parent, device_t self, void *aux)
{
       struct sbus_attach_args *sa = aux;
       struct gem_sbus_softc *gsc = device_private(self);
       struct gem_softc *sc = &gsc->gsc_gem;
       uint8_t enaddr[ETHER_ADDR_LEN];

       sc->sc_dev = self;

       /* Pass on the bus tags */
       sc->sc_bustag = sa->sa_bustag;
       sc->sc_dmatag = sa->sa_dmatag;

       if (sa->sa_nreg < 2) {
               printf("%s: only %d register sets\n",
                       device_xname(self), sa->sa_nreg);
               return;
       }

       /*
        * Map two register banks:
        *
        *      bank 0: status, config, reset
        *      bank 1: various gem parts
        *
        */
       if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
                        sa->sa_reg[0].oa_space,
                        sa->sa_reg[0].oa_base,
                        (bus_size_t)sa->sa_reg[0].oa_size,
                        0, &sc->sc_h2) != 0) {
               a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map registers\n");
               return;
       }
       if (sbus_bus_map(sa->sa_bustag,
                        sa->sa_reg[1].oa_space,
                        sa->sa_reg[1].oa_base,
                        (bus_size_t)sa->sa_reg[1].oa_size,
                        0, &sc->sc_h1) != 0) {
               aprint_error_dev(self, "cannot map registers\n");
               return;
       }
       prom_getether(sa->sa_node, enaddr);

       if (!strcmp("serdes", prom_getpropstring(sa->sa_node, "shared-pins")))
               sc->sc_flags |= GEM_SERDES;
       sc->sc_variant = GEM_SUN_GEM;
       sc->sc_flags &= ~GEM_PCI;

       /*
        * SBUS config
        */
       (void) bus_space_read_4(sa->sa_bustag, sc->sc_h2, GEM_SBUS_RESET);
       delay(100);
       bus_space_write_4(sa->sa_bustag, sc->sc_h2, GEM_SBUS_CONFIG,
           GEM_SBUS_CFG_BSIZE128|GEM_SBUS_CFG_PARITY|GEM_SBUS_CFG_BMODE64);
       sc->sc_chiprev = bus_space_read_4(sa->sa_bustag, sc->sc_h2,
           GEM_SBUS_REVISION);

       printf(": GEM Ethernet controller (%s), version %s (rev 0x%02x)\n",
           sa->sa_name, prom_getpropstring(sa->sa_node, "version"),
           sc->sc_chiprev);

       gem_attach(sc, enaddr);

       /* Establish interrupt handler */
       if (sa->sa_nintr != 0)
               gsc->gsc_ih = bus_intr_establish(sa->sa_bustag, sa->sa_pri, IPL_NET,
                                       gem_intr, sc);
}
